December 14, 2020 โ Two days after Mondayโs decision to close the federal waters of Cook Inlet to commercial salmon fishermen, Alaskaโs senior Senator Lisa Murkowski called for โthe need to collaboratively resolve tensions that have long persisted in Cook Inlet.โ The decision came at the beginning of the North Pacific Fisheries Management Councilโs December meeting.
The โhistorical tensionsโ the senator referred to have been between both commercial and recreational fishermen and between all fishermen and the Alaska Department of Fish and Game. Cook Inlet is home to Alaskaโs largest city, Anchorage, the nearby Matenuska-Susitna Borough, and the stateโs most popular recreational area, the Kenai Peninsula. About two-thirds of the stateโs population lives on or near Cook Inlet, which is accessed by the stateโs only road system.
